Arc Lighters: How do they work?
Arc lighters, also known as plasma lighters or electric lighters, operate based on the principles of electrical energy and ionization. They utilize a rechargeable battery to power an electric circuit that generates a high voltage current. When activated, this current passes through a small gap between two conductive electrodes, creating an electric arc or plasma discharge. The heat generated by the arc is sufficient to ignite flammable materials.
Unlike traditional lighters that rely on a fuel source such as butane, arc lighters don''t produce an open flame, making them windproof and resistant to extinguishing in adverse weather conditions. Additionally, arc lighters are rechargeable, eliminating the need for constant refills or disposables.
Tasers: The electo-shock weapons
On the other hand, tasers are electroshock weapons primarily used by law enforcement agencies for self-defense purposes. They are designed to temporarily incapacitate individuals by delivering high-voltage electric shocks. The most common type of taser is a Conducted Electrical Weapon (CEW) that shoots two barbed darts attached to thin wires, delivering an electric shock to the target.
When fired, the taser''s barbed darts penetrate the target''s clothing and skin, completing the circuit between the two electrodes. The electrical current sent through the wires causes neuromuscular incapacitation, resulting in temporary muscle contraction, pain, and disorientation. Tasers are considered a less-lethal option for controlling individuals without causing long-lasting harm or fatalities.
Different Mechanisms and Functionality
Although both arc lighters and tasers utilize electricity, their underlying mechanisms and functionalities are significantly different. Arc lighters generate a continuous electric arc or plasma discharge to ignite materials, while tasers deliver a momentary electrical shock to incapacitate a target. The levels of voltage and current also vary significantly between the two devices.
Arc lighters typically generate a low voltage current ranging from 10,000 to 20,000 volts, which is sufficient to produce a stable electric arc. In contrast, tasers operate at much higher voltages, often exceeding 50,000 volts. However, it''s essential to note that the voltage alone doesn''t determine the lethality or effectiveness of a device; factors such as current, duration, and the path of electrical current also play substantial roles.

Legal and Regulatory Differences
Arc lighters, being primarily used for igniting materials, have fewer legal restrictions compared to tasers. In most places, arc lighters are considered similar to traditional flame lighters and are exempt from specific regulations. However, it''s always advisable to check local laws and regulations regarding flameless lighters before purchasing or carrying one.
Tasers, on the other hand, are highly regulated due to their potential for misuse and harm. The possession and use of tasers are subject to strict regulations that vary depending on the country, state, or locality. In many jurisdictions, tasers are restricted to use by law enforcement agencies or require special permits for civilian use.
